How much should I pay for a dental chair?

by:Golden Promise     2023-06-06

Are you planning on opening a dental practice or upgrading your current one? One of the most significant investments you'll make is purchasing a dental chair. A dental chair is at the heart of your practice, and it's essential to ensure you get the right one at the appropriate price. In this article, we'll explore the factors that determine the cost of a dental chair and how much you should expect to pay.


Factors that Affect the Cost of a Dental Chair


1. Type of Dental Chair


The type of dental chair is one of the primary factors that influence the price. There are various types of dental chairs in the market, ranging from traditional hydraulic chairs to the latest ergonomic models. The basic hydraulic chair will cost you less than $4,000, while the top-of-the-range ergonomic model can set you back up to $20,000.


2. Brand


Another factor that affects the cost of a dental chair is the brand. Some brands are known for their quality, durability, and comfort. These factors determine their pricing. For instance, a chair from a highly reputable brand like A-dec will cost more than an average brand.


3. Additional Features


An average dental chair comes with the basic features like hydraulic base, adjustable headrest, and armrests, but some advanced models have additional features like LED lights, intra-oral cameras, ultrasonic scaling, and many more. The more features a chair has, the higher the cost.


4. Warranty and Maintenance


Purchasing a dental chair is a long-term financial commitment, so it's crucial to ensure you get a product with a reliable warranty and maintenance plan. A chair that comes with a more extended warranty and maintenance plan will cost more than one with shorter and less comprehensive ones.


5. Supplier


The supplier is another important factor that affects the cost of a dental chair. The supplier's location, whether local or international, logistics, and maintenance services offered play a role in the price.


How Much Should You Pay for a Dental Chair?


The cost of a dental chair varies widely, from as low as $2,000 up to $20,000 dollars. However, an average, good quality dental chair will cost you between $7,000 to $10,000.


The type of dental chair you select will determine the range in that bracket that you end up in. For example, a basic hydraulic-operated chair will cost around $4,000. A mid-range chair with more features like an intra-oral camera, ultrasonic scaler and LED light can cost upwards of $6,000 to $9,000. High-end dental chairs with ergonomic features can cost between $8,000 to $20,000.


When budgeting, consider the chair's features, quality, warranty, and maintenance plan to get the best value for your money.


Dental Chair Financing Options


Purchasing a dental chair is a significant investment, and not everyone can afford the cost upfront. However, financing options are available to make it easier to purchase the equipment. Here are some of the financing options that you may consider.


1. Bank Loans


Most banks offer loans to small businesses and entrepreneurs looking to purchase equipment. The loans usually come with flexible payment schedules that match your cash flow.


2. Lease Financing


Lease financing is another alternative for financing your dental chair purchase. Leasing allows you to enjoy the benefits of the equipment without having to purchase it outright. In addition, it comes with more manageable monthly payments that align with your business' revenue stream.


3. Vendor Financing


Some vendors offer financing options to make their equipment more accessible to their customers. These options have different payment plans that allow you to select the best plan for your business.


Conclusion


A dental chair is a crucial component of any dental practice. The chair cost varies depending on its features, brand, type, supplier, warranty, and maintenance. On average, expect to pay between $7,000 to $10,000 for a good quality chair. Before purchasing, consider your budget, financing options, and your practice's needs to choose the right chair for your business.
